Good news! I just got off the phone with Brian at Unibiker and he is anxious to get started. So I am taking my bike over to him in the morning and he will be getting started on the design and fab of our guards.
He said that based on what he has seen of the KLX that he thought that our guards would be very similar to the KLX 450. They are 2 piece units that feature a reinforced rear brace that bolts to a front face guard.
http://www.unabiker.com/mm5/merchant.mvc?Screen=PROD&Store_Code=UR&Pro duct_Code=KKLX07450R&Category_Code=K5

They look good to me so while I'm there I'm going to get a set for the KX250F (black anodized)

With a little luck you guys will be able to purchase these as soon as next week!
